Roof damage restoration services focus on repairing and restoring roofs that have suffered from various forms of damage, including storms, fallen debris, leaks, or aging materials. These services typically involve a thorough assessment of the affected areas, removal of damaged shingles or roofing components, and the installation of new materials to restore the roof’s integrity. Skilled contractors may also perform repairs to underlying structures, such as rafters or sheathing, to ensure the roof is stable and secure. The goal of restoration is to extend the lifespan of the roof and prevent further issues that could lead to interior damage or more costly repairs.
These services help address common problems like leaks, water intrusion, and deterioration caused by weather events or prolonged exposure to the elements. Damaged roofs can lead to interior water damage, mold growth, and structural issues if not properly repaired. Roof damage restoration aims to mitigate these risks by fixing vulnerabilities quickly and effectively. Restoration professionals often identify underlying issues that might not be immediately visible, ensuring that repairs are comprehensive and durable. This proactive approach helps property owners protect their investments and maintain the safety and functionality of their buildings.

The overview below groups typical Roof Damage Restoration proj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Frederick County, MD.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Repair Costs - The cost for basic roof damage repairs typically ranges from $300 to $1,200, depending on the extent of the damage. Small leaks or minor shingle replacements are common examples within this range.
Replacement Expenses - Full roof replacements due to severe damage can cost between $5,000 and $15,000 or more. Factors influencing costs include roof size, materials, and complexity.
Material Costs - The choice of roofing materials impacts overall expenses, with asphalt shingles averaging around $100 to $150 per square. Premium materials like metal or tile can increase costs significantly.
Additional Charges - Extra services such as waterproofing or insulation upgrades may add $500 to $2,000 to the total cost. These are often recommended based on the extent of roof damage and local conditions.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es roof damage that requires restoration? Roof damage can result from severe weather, such as storms or hail, falling debris, or aging materials that lead to leaks and structural issues.
How can I tell if my roof needs restoration? Signs include visible damage like missing shingles, water stains on ceilings, or increased energy bills indicating potential leaks or insulation issues.
What services do roof damage restoration providers offer? They typically perform inspections, repairs for leaks and damaged materials, and full restoration to restore roof integrity and appearance.
Is roof damage restoration suitable for all types of roofs? Restoration services are available for a variety of roofing materials, including asphalt, wood, metal, and tile, depending on the extent of damage.
How long does roof damage restoration usually take? The duration varies based on the extent of damage and the size of the roof, with local service providers providing assessments to determine timelines.
